Hypolipidemic effects of three purgative decoctions
Sung-Hui Tseng1, Ting-Yi Chien, Jiun-Rong Chen
1School of Medicine, Taipei Medical University, 250 Wu- Xing Street, Taipei 110, Taiwan.
Traditional Chinese Medicine purgatives Xiao-Chen-Chi-Tang (XCCT) and Tiao-Wei-Chen-Chi-Tang (TWCCT) show promise for treating hyperlipidemia by lowering cholesterol and triglycerides without affecting body weight.

Background:
- TCM uses purgatives like Ta-Cheng-Chi-Tang (TCCT), Xiao-Chen-Chi-Tang (XCCT), and Tiao-Wei-Chen-Chi-Tang (TWCCT) for illnesses linked to internal heat accumulation.
- Obesity with specific symptoms is often treated with these purgatives, with rhubarb as a key ingredient.
- Previous research indicated TCCT's anti-inflammatory and XCCT's antioxidant properties.
Purpose of the Study:
- To review the literature on rhubarb's effects on lipid and weight control.
- To investigate the anti-obesity and lipid-lowering effects of TCCT, XCCT, TWCCT, and rhubarb extracts in animal models.
Main Methods:
- Literature review on rhubarb and its preparations for lipid and weight management.
- In vivo studies using two animal models to assess the effects of TCCT, XCCT, TWCCT, and rhubarb extracts.
- Evaluation of serum lipid concentrations, body weight, and renal/hepatic function.
Main Results:
- Tiao-Wei-Chen-Chi-Tang (TWCCT) demonstrated significant triglyceride reduction in mice, comparable to fenofibrate.
- Xiao-Chen-Chi-Tang (XCCT) and TWCCT attenuated high-fat diet-induced hypercholesterolemia in rats.
- TWCCT also reduced high-fat diet-induced hypertriglyceridemia in rats.
- No adverse effects on renal or hepatic function were observed.
- None of the tested extracts reduced body weight in high-fat diet-fed rats.
Conclusions:
- XCCT and TWCCT show potential therapeutic benefits for hyperlipidemia.
- These TCM formulations may help manage cholesterol and triglyceride levels.
- Further research is warranted to explore their clinical application in metabolic disorders.
